One of those hard-hitting!!, ass-kicking, drill-sergeant style motivational books. Those are helpful sometimes, I guess.
…no one can seriously fuck up your life quite as magnificently as you can. And you do.
Real breakthroughs become available in your life when you interrupt yourself and your automatic responses to whatever life presents you with.
The single most important thing you can do for your life is to release anyone (including yourself!) from blame for how your life has turned out. …Ultimately, figuring out who is to blame solves nothing. All it does is explain and keep you stuck. You have to be willing to own your life for how it is, no blame, no anger, no resentment. It went the way it did, you turned out the way you did, and now it’s game on and into the future we go.
